HomeSort by relevance Sort by last modified time
    Searched refs:RegUses (Results 1 - 13 of 13) sorted by null

  /external/swiftshader/third_party/LLVM/lib/Target/Sparc/
DelaySlotFiller.cpp 65 SmallSet<unsigned, 32>& RegUses);
69 SmallSet<unsigned, 32>& RegUses);
77 SmallSet<unsigned, 32> &RegUses);
133 SmallSet<unsigned, 32> RegUses;
153 insertCallUses(slot, RegUses);
155 insertDefsUses(slot, RegDefs, RegUses);
177 if (delayHasHazard(I, sawLoad, sawStore, RegDefs, RegUses)) {
178 insertDefsUses(I, RegDefs, RegUses);
191 SmallSet<unsigned, 32> &RegUses)
220 if (IsRegInSet(RegDefs, Reg) || IsRegInSet(RegUses, Reg)
    [all...]
  /external/swiftshader/third_party/LLVM/lib/Target/Mips/
MipsDelaySlotFiller.cpp 68 SmallSet<unsigned, 32>& RegUses);
72 SmallSet<unsigned, 32>& RegUses);
80 SmallSet<unsigned, 32> &RegUses);
130 SmallSet<unsigned, 32> RegUses;
132 insertDefsUses(slot, RegDefs, RegUses);
157 if (delayHasHazard(FI, sawLoad, sawStore, RegDefs, RegUses)) {
158 insertDefsUses(FI, RegDefs, RegUses);
173 SmallSet<unsigned, 32> &RegUses) {
206 if (IsRegInSet(RegDefs, Reg) || IsRegInSet(RegUses, Reg))
218 // Insert Defs and Uses of MI into the sets RegDefs and RegUses
    [all...]
  /external/llvm/lib/Target/Lanai/
LanaiDelaySlotFiller.cpp 68 SmallSet<unsigned, 32> &RegUses);
74 SmallSet<unsigned, 32> &RegUses);
150 SmallSet<unsigned, 32> RegUses;
152 insertDefsUses(Slot, RegDefs, RegUses);
170 if (delayHasHazard(FI, SawLoad, SawStore, RegDefs, RegUses)) {
171 insertDefsUses(FI, RegDefs, RegUses);
182 SmallSet<unsigned, 32> &RegUses) {
214 if (isRegInSet(RegDefs, Reg) || isRegInSet(RegUses, Reg))
226 // Insert Defs and Uses of MI into the sets RegDefs and RegUses.
229 SmallSet<unsigned, 32> &RegUses) {
    [all...]
  /external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/Lanai/
LanaiDelaySlotFiller.cpp 68 SmallSet<unsigned, 32> &RegUses);
74 SmallSet<unsigned, 32> &RegUses);
149 SmallSet<unsigned, 32> RegUses;
151 insertDefsUses(Slot, RegDefs, RegUses);
169 if (delayHasHazard(FI, SawLoad, SawStore, RegDefs, RegUses)) {
170 insertDefsUses(FI, RegDefs, RegUses);
181 SmallSet<unsigned, 32> &RegUses) {
213 if (isRegInSet(RegDefs, Reg) || isRegInSet(RegUses, Reg))
225 // Insert Defs and Uses of MI into the sets RegDefs and RegUses.
228 SmallSet<unsigned, 32> &RegUses) {
    [all...]
  /external/llvm/lib/Target/Sparc/
DelaySlotFiller.cpp 72 SmallSet<unsigned, 32>& RegUses);
76 SmallSet<unsigned, 32>& RegUses);
84 SmallSet<unsigned, 32> &RegUses);
174 SmallSet<unsigned, 32> RegUses;
198 insertCallDefsUses(slot, RegDefs, RegUses);
200 insertDefsUses(slot, RegDefs, RegUses);
220 if (delayHasHazard(I, sawLoad, sawStore, RegDefs, RegUses)) {
221 insertDefsUses(I, RegDefs, RegUses);
234 SmallSet<unsigned, 32> &RegUses)
263 if (IsRegInSet(RegDefs, Reg) || IsRegInSet(RegUses, Reg)
    [all...]
  /external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/Sparc/
DelaySlotFiller.cpp 70 SmallSet<unsigned, 32>& RegUses);
74 SmallSet<unsigned, 32>& RegUses);
82 SmallSet<unsigned, 32> &RegUses);
172 SmallSet<unsigned, 32> RegUses;
196 insertCallDefsUses(slot, RegDefs, RegUses);
198 insertDefsUses(slot, RegDefs, RegUses);
218 if (delayHasHazard(I, sawLoad, sawStore, RegDefs, RegUses)) {
219 insertDefsUses(I, RegDefs, RegUses);
232 SmallSet<unsigned, 32> &RegUses)
261 if (IsRegInSet(RegDefs, Reg) || IsRegInSet(RegUses, Reg)
    [all...]
  /external/swiftshader/third_party/subzero/src/
IceRegAlloc.cpp 466 // Decrement Item from RegUses[].
470 --RegUses[RegAlias];
471 assert(RegUses[RegAlias] >= 0);
490 // Increment Item in RegUses[].
494 assert(RegUses[RegAlias] >= 0);
495 ++RegUses[RegAlias];
628 assert(RegUses[RegAlias] >= 0);
629 ++RegUses[RegAlias];
641 assert(RegUses[RegAlias] >= 0);
642 ++RegUses[RegAlias]
    [all...]
IceRegAlloc.h 127 /// RegUses[I] is the number of live ranges (variables) that register I is
130 llvm::SmallVector<int32_t, REGS_SIZE> RegUses;
  /external/llvm/lib/CodeGen/
ImplicitNullChecks.cpp 150 DenseSet<unsigned> RegUses;
216 RegUses.insert(MO.getReg());
283 for (unsigned Reg : RegUses)
  /external/swiftshader/third_party/LLVM/lib/Transforms/Scalar/
LoopStrengthReduce.cpp 174 // Update RegUses. The data structure is not optimized for this purpose;
243 const RegUseTracker &RegUses) const;
360 const RegUseTracker &RegUses) const {
362 if (RegUses.isRegUsedByUsesOtherThan(ScaledReg, LUIdx))
366 if (RegUses.isRegUsedByUsesOtherThan(*I, LUIdx))
    [all...]
  /external/swiftshader/third_party/llvm-7.0/llvm/lib/Transforms/Scalar/
LoopStrengthReduce.cpp 272 // Update RegUses. The data structure is not optimized for this purpose;
367 const RegUseTracker &RegUses) const;
563 const RegUseTracker &RegUses) const {
565 if (RegUses.isRegUsedByUsesOtherThan(ScaledReg, LUIdx))
568 if (RegUses.isRegUsedByUsesOtherThan(BaseReg, LUIdx))
    [all...]
  /external/llvm/lib/Transforms/Scalar/
LoopStrengthReduce.cpp 207 // Update RegUses. The data structure is not optimized for this purpose;
298 const RegUseTracker &RegUses) const;
456 const RegUseTracker &RegUses) const {
458 if (RegUses.isRegUsedByUsesOtherThan(ScaledReg, LUIdx))
461 if (RegUses.isRegUsedByUsesOtherThan(BaseReg, LUIdx))
    [all...]
  /external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/AMDGPU/
GCNRegPressure.cpp 316 auto const RegUses = collectVirtualRegUses(MI, LIS, *MRI);
320 for (const auto &U : RegUses) {
343 for (const auto &U : RegUses) {

Completed in 867 milliseconds